Control: The Ultimate Edition has officially arrived on the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series consoles. So tech analysis expert NXGamer breaks down exactly what to expect when you jump into the game on one of the new consoles. Control: Ultimate Edition offers a few graphics modes depending on the console you have. For PS5 and Xbox Series X owners, you’ll have a choice of Performance Mode which targets smoother 60fps, and Graphics Mode which locks in framerate at 30fps but increases overall graphics fidelity and activates ray tracing. Xbox Series S owners can only choose Performance mode. Control is a third-person action-adventure in which the main protagonist Jesse takes on the role of director of the Federal Office of Control.
